In our daily life, climacteric syndrome is absolutely a very common disease, for this disease, we must pay enough attention, climacteric syndrome is a series of symptoms caused by the decline of estrogen levels. Menopausal women, due to ovarian dysfunction, pituitary hyperfunction, secrete too much gonadotropin, cause autonomic nerve dysfunction, resulting in a series of different degrees of symptoms, menopausal syndrome what symptoms. What symptom does menopausal syndrome have
First: menopausal women, due to the dysfunction of autonomic nervous system, lack of estrogen, love to be irritable, love to lose temper, poor self-control, sensitive and suspicious, often prone to depression. Temperament also changes, moody, or wishful thinking, shadowy, lack of trust and so on.
Second: the whole body skin appears slack, the breast begins to droop, wrinkles increase, subcutaneous fat is richer than before, the body becomes fat, a variety of elderly chronic diseases appear. So often depressed, sad, depressed to cry, or nervous, nervous, palpitations, chest tightness, headache, head weight, unstable blood pressure, menstrual disorders and sexual dysfunction.
Third: there may be numbness of limbs, fatigue, hand tremor, sweating, or sudden cold and heat. The significant decline of ovarian function and the significant decrease of estrogen level lead to the decrease of vaginal secretion and elasticity, pain, irritability and even apathy in sexual life.
